PACIFIC HEIGHTS

Located atop San Francisco's most iconic ridge, Pacific Heights is an affluent neighborhood that offers breathtaking views of the San Francisco Bay, Golden Gate Bridge, Alcatraz, and the city skyline. This prestigious neighborhood is nestled between Presidio Avenue and Van Ness Avenue and is surrounded by other upscale neighborhoods such as Presidio Heights, Cow Hollow, and Russian Hill.

Pacific Heights is home to a diverse mix of affluent residents, including entrepreneurs, business executives, and celebrities. The neighborhood has become increasingly popular among tech industry moguls, venture capitalists, and international buyers, who are drawn to the area's prestige and exquisite homes.

The architecture in Pacific Heights is characterized by a wide range of styles, from Victorian and Edwardian to Beaux-Arts and modern designs. Many of these homes boast intricate details and beautiful facades. The neighborhood is also known for its historic mansions, such as the Spreckels Mansion, the Haas-Lilienthal House, and the Flood Mansion, some of which have been converted into private schools or cultural institutions.

Adding to the charm of Pacific Heights are its lovely parks, Alta Plaza Park and Lafayette Park, which provide residents with green spaces for relaxation, exercise, and enjoying stunning views. Throughout the year, these parks host various events, contributing to the vibrant community atmosphere.

The bustling Fillmore Street commercial district runs through Pacific Heights, offering residents an array of upscale shopping, dining, and entertainment options. The neighborhood's high real estate prices reflect its desirability and impressive architecture, with homes reaching well into the 10+ million-dollar range.

Pacific Heights is also home to several prestigious private schools, including Town School for Boys, Convent & Stuart Hall, and San Francisco University High School, making it an attractive destination for families.
